반응형
UILabel-줄 바꿈 텍스트
필요에 따라 레이블 줄 바꿈 텍스트를 가질 수있는 방법이 있습니까? 줄 바꿈을 단어 줄 바꿈으로 설정하고 레이블이 두 줄에 충분할만큼 키가 크지 만 줄 바꿈에서만 줄 바꿈되는 것처럼 보입니다. 줄 바꿈을 추가하여 제대로 줄 바꿈해야합니까? 가로로 맞지 않으면 포장하고 싶습니다.
를 설정하면 numberOfLines
0 (워드 랩에 라벨) 필요에 따라 레이블이 자동으로 라인의 많은으로 싸서 사용한다.
UILabel
IB에서를 편집하는 경우 option+ return를 눌러 여러 줄의 텍스트를 입력 하여 줄 바꿈을 할 수 return있습니다. 혼자 편집하면됩니다.
UILabel
lineBreakMode
요구 사항에 따라 설정할 수 있는 속성 이 있습니다.
Swift에서는 다음과 같이합니다.
label.lineBreakMode = NSLineBreakMode.ByWordWrapping
label.numberOfLines = 0
(lineBreakMode 상수가 작동하는 방식은 ObjC와 다릅니다)
Xcode 10, 스위프트 4
레이블을 선택하고 속성 관리자를 사용하여 스토리 보드에서 레이블의 텍스트 줄 바꿈을 수행 할 수도 있습니다.
줄 = 0 줄 바꿈 = 줄 바꿈
참고 URL : https://stackoverflow.com/questions/1121358/uilabel-wordwrap-text
반응형
'programing tip' 카테고리의 다른 글
다른 테이블에없는 행을 선택하십시오. (0) | 2020.06.15 |
---|---|
이 milw0rm 힙 스프레이 익스플로잇은 어떻게 작동합니까? (0) | 2020.06.15 |
BigDecimal에 대한 추가 (0) | 2020.06.15 |
git init을 두 번 실행하면 리포지토리가 초기화되거나 기존 리포지토리가 다시 초기화됩니까? (0) | 2020.06.15 |
iPhone-그랜드 센트럴 디스패치 메인 스레드 (0) | 2020.06.15 |